The Surge Score a Season High 11 Runs in Win Over Springfield

May 8, 2021

May 7, 2021

Wichita - 11

Springfield- 7

Springfield, MO – The Wind Surge pounded out a season high eleven runs, sixteen hits and four home runs and defeated Springfield 11-7 to win for the third time in their first four games.

Jose Miranda hit a pair of home runs and drove in three runs, Peter Mooney added a two run home run and Jermaine Palacios hit a solo home run to lead the Wichita offense.

The Surge scored three runs in the first, but the Cardinals stormed back getting a two-run home run from Ivan Herrera and scoring four runs. The Wind Surge grabbed the lead in the fourth scoring two runs and never looked back. Wichita scored runs in five consecutive innings and the bullpen finished off the Cardinals.

Wind Surge reliever Jovani Moran earned the win working two scoreless innings and Springfield starter Kyle Leahy suffered the defeat.

NOTES- Wichita made its first error in the eighth inning after starting the season playing 33 clean innings of defense. Aaron Whitefield extended his hit streak to four games and is eight for seventeen on the season with five RBI.
